20%=
20100=
15 Luke's share : Total share = 1 : 5
The total amount paid for the present is repeated. Make the total amount the same. LCM of 10 and 6 is 30.
Amount that Oliver, Justin and Japheth paid = 25 u
Amount that Oliver and Justin paid
= 25 u - 9 u
= 16 u
The amount that Oliver and Justin each paid is the same.
Amount that Oliver and Justin each paid
= 16 u ÷ 2
= 8 u
Cost of the present = 30 u
30 u = 330
1 u = 330 ÷ 30 = 11
Amount that Justin paid
= 8 u
= 8 x 11
= $88
Answer(s): $88
